A prime TFSA inventory with month-to-month payouts
Slate Grocery REIT primarily focuses on grocery-anchored actual property throughout main U.S. metropolitan markets. These properties function important neighborhood hubs, housing grocery shops and different important retailers. This deal with necessity-based retail helps present it with steady occupancy and recurring rental revenue.
Regardless of the broader market volatility and financial uncertainties, Slate Grocery inventory has climbed by 15%. In consequence, it at present trades at $17.19 per share, giving the belief a market capitalization of barely greater than $1 billion. Extra importantly for revenue traders, it rewards traders with enticing month-to-month dividends, with its annualized yield at present standing at round 6.9%.
Robust working momentum
Within the newest quarter resulted in March 2026, Slate’s rental income rose by 11.8% 12 months over 12 months (YoY) to US$59.3 million with the assistance of robust leasing exercise and better rental charges. Throughout the interval, the true property funding belief (REIT) accomplished greater than 725,000 sq. toes of leasing exercise at double-digit rental spreads.
Its renewal leases had been accomplished at charges 18.9% above expiring rents, whereas new leases had been signed at charges 49% above the comparable common in-place rents. These constructive elements clearly present Slate Grocery REIT’s pricing energy and provides it a powerful basis for future income development.
For the quarter, the REIT additionally reported same-property web working revenue (NOI) development of two.1% on a trailing 12-month foundation after adjusting for accomplished redevelopment tasks. On the similar time, its portfolio occupancy remained stable at 94.4%, highlighting the continued demand for its grocery-anchored properties.
A stable basis for future development
Past its present working energy, Slate Grocery REIT maintains a weighted common rate of interest of 5%, with 90.2% of its debt carrying fastened rates of interest. These fastened charges give it stability in financing prices and scale back publicity to rate of interest volatility.
In the meantime, the REIT can be exploring alternatives to boost unitholder worth because it lately fashioned a particular committee to evaluate strategic alternate options, together with a possible sale of the belief.
